Weather in March

March, the first month of the spring in Sayfaf, is a hot month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 31.2°C (88.2°F) and 25.7°C (78.3°F).

Temperature

The shift into March uncovers an average high-temperature of a hot 31.2°C (88.2°F), subtly different from the previous month. An average low-temperature of 25.7°C (78.3°F) is anticipated throughout the nights during March.

Heat index

March's mean heat index is computed to be a sweltering 37°C (98.6°F). Adopt additional preventive measures, heat cramps and heat exhaustion are potential outcomes. Prolonged activity may trigger heatstroke.
Given the heat index, its values are aligned with shaded sites and gentle winds. Direct sunshine exposure could raise heat index values by as much as 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'felt air temperature', blends air temperature and moisture content to represent the felt temperature to humans. The influence of weather is personal, with varied individuals experiencing it differently due to differences in body mass, stature, and physical exertion levels. Given the impact of direct sunlight, it's noteworthy that the felt temperature can rise by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are especially vital to children. Young ones often do not realize the necessity to rest and replenish their fluids. Thirst is a delayed indication of dehydration - keeping hydrated, particularly in prolonged physical activity, is crucial.
The human body normally cools itself by perspiration. Excessive warmth is eliminated from the body by evaporation of sweat. When there is an excess of moisture in the atmosphere, the efficiency of the evaporation process is lessened, leading to less efficient body cooling and a sensation of overheating. Rising body temperatures resulting from an imbalance in heat absorption can lead to potential thermal issues.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in March is 65%.

Rainfall

In March, in Sayfaf, the rain falls for 3.8 days. Throughout March, 3mm (0.12") of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 45.7 rainfall days, and 86mm (3.39")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

In Sayfaf, the average length of the day in March is 12h and 4min.
On the first day of March, sunrise is at 06:26 and sunset at 18:17.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 06:05 and sunset at 18:21 +03.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in March in Sayfaf is 9.5h.
